Electrician Salary in Iowa

Entry-level electricians in Iowa earn around $38,950 per year. The median salary is $62,880, which is 0.9% above the national median of $62,350. Top earners make up to $86,890 per year.

Iowa vs. National Electrician Wages
MetricIowaNational
Median salary$62,880$62,350
Average salary$63,910$69,630
25th percentile$48,010$48,820
75th percentile$80,200$81,730
90th percentile$86,890$106,030

Iowa employs approximately 8,900 electricians (5.7 per 1,000 workers, location quotient: 1.18).

Source: U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ics, May 2024.

Electrician Job Outlook

9.5% growth (2024–2034)

Employment of electricians is projected to grow 9.5% from 2024 to 2034, much faster than the average for all occupations. This represents a change from 818,700 to 896,100 jobs nationwide. About 81,000 openings are projected each year on average over the decade, driven by workers transferring to other occupations, retiring, or leaving the labor force.
